[發(fā)明專利]智能配電終端通信弱耦合模塊化系統(tǒng)及方法有效
| 申請?zhí)枺?/td> | 201610067034.1 | 申請日: | 2016-01-29 |
| 公開(公告)號: | CN105635173B | 公開(公告)日: | 2019-03-22 |
| 發(fā)明(設計)人: | 熊建成;管荑;李偉碩;孟祥軍;張曉花;曹淑英;楊娜 | 申請(專利權)人: | 山東魯能智能技術有限公司 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06 |
| 代理公司: | 濟南圣達知識產權代理有限公司 37221 | 代理人: | 張勇 |
| 地址: | 250101 山東省濟南*** | 國省代碼: | 山東;37 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 智能 配電 終端 通信 耦合 模塊化 系統(tǒng) 方法 | ||
1.一種智能配電終端通信弱耦合模塊化系統(tǒng),其特征是,包括:通信管理主系統(tǒng)和規(guī)約動態(tài)庫;所述規(guī)約動態(tài)庫中集成有不同類型的規(guī)約程序;所述通信管理主系統(tǒng)提供接口加載所述規(guī)約動態(tài)庫中的規(guī)約程序;
通信管理主系統(tǒng)根據加載的規(guī)約程序開啟獨立的線程與加載的規(guī)約程序進行綁定,然后將數據組織成規(guī)約所需的數據類型傳遞給各種不同的規(guī)約;
所述通信管理主系統(tǒng)對于每個規(guī)約程序設置一個線程池來對所有規(guī)約線程進行調度和管理,只有在通信端口配置該規(guī)約后才啟動該規(guī)約線程,以最大限度的減小通信管理主系統(tǒng)的開銷;
每種規(guī)約都是一個獨立的程序,在規(guī)約出現問題過程中,只要定位出是哪種類型的規(guī)約出現問題,然后只需調整該規(guī)約,不會影響通信管理主系統(tǒng)和其他規(guī)約的運行;
所述規(guī)約動態(tài)庫將通信管理主系統(tǒng)下發(fā)或者相應規(guī)約客戶端上送的報文進行處理,獲取有用的數據信息并存在相應的緩存中,然后根據規(guī)約中標準的協(xié)議類型和組包格式下發(fā)或上送給其他的應用程序。
2.如權利要求1所述的一種智能配電終端通信弱耦合模塊化系統(tǒng),其特征是,所述規(guī)約動態(tài)庫用于實現在每個規(guī)約設計程序中對接收到的報文進行打解包處理,然后在每個規(guī)約中來獲取有用的數據信息并組織數據報文存儲在系統(tǒng)定義的公用緩存中,然后根據規(guī)約中標準的協(xié)議類型和組包格式下發(fā)或上送給其他的應用程序,在應用程序中經過反串序列化后將打包的數據解析成應用程序理解的數據單元。
3.如權利要求2所述的一種智能配電終端通信弱耦合模塊化系統(tǒng),其特征是,所述數據報文至少包含數據包頭、數據實體單元、數據應用單元、數據信息體信息,根據規(guī)約中共用屬性和方法抽象出規(guī)約基類,該基類主要實現處理報文中的數據包頭、數據實體單元和數據應用單元。
4.一種如權利要求1所述的智能配電終端通信弱耦合模塊化系統(tǒng)的方法,其特征是,包括以下步驟:
(1)系統(tǒng)初始化;
(2)生成規(guī)約動態(tài) 庫并對各規(guī)約進行命名;
(3)通信管理主系統(tǒng)通過接口加載生成的規(guī)約動態(tài)庫中的N個規(guī)約程序;
(4)通信管理主系統(tǒng)通過系統(tǒng)配置文件來判斷規(guī)約程序加載數量N,如果N>1,則通信管理主系統(tǒng)開啟N個獨立的線程與加載的規(guī)約程序進行綁定,并獲取相應的規(guī)約參數,生成規(guī)約動態(tài)庫中的N個規(guī)約線程,進入下一步;否則,轉至步驟(7);
(5)判斷規(guī)約程序線程個數M,如果M<N,則有規(guī)約程序啟動不成功,對于啟動不成功的規(guī)約程序,重新生成新的動態(tài)規(guī)約程序集成到規(guī)約動態(tài) 庫,返回至步驟(3)重新加載;對于啟動成功的規(guī)約程序,轉至步驟(7);
(6)如果M=N,說明規(guī)約程序全部啟動成功,進入下一步;
(7)運行規(guī)約程序,實現數據的緩存與轉發(fā)。
5.如權利要求4所述的一種智能配電終端通信弱耦合模塊化系統(tǒng)的方法,其特征是,對于規(guī)約的命名,以“l(fā)ibptl_規(guī)約名”方式命名,生成dll或者.so文件。
6.如權利要求4所述的一種智能配電終端通信弱耦合模塊化系統(tǒng)的方法,其特征是,通信管理主系統(tǒng)根據加載的規(guī)約程序開啟獨立的線程與加載的規(guī)約程序進行綁定,對每個所述規(guī)約程序設置一個線程池來進行規(guī)約所需線程的調度工作。
7.如權利要求4所述的一種智能配電終端通信弱耦合模塊化系統(tǒng)的方法,其特征是,通過判斷是否調用規(guī)約線程以及規(guī)約線程是否啟動,通過查找對應規(guī)約線程的唯一標識,控制規(guī)約進程停止或者啟動,減小系統(tǒng)開銷。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于山東魯能智能技術有限公司,未經山東魯能智能技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業(yè)授權和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610067034.1/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種免焊接組合電池
- 下一篇:一種具有超晶格P型半導體層的硅薄膜太陽能電池





